Smriti Mandhana Becomes the First Indian Woman to Score Centuries in All Three Formats

Record-breaking century powers India to biggest-ever T20I win over England

By Pradeep Gurusinghe
Published: June 29, 2025
©Getty Images
SHARE

Indian opener Smriti Mandhana has become the first and only woman cricketer from India to score centuries in Tests, ODIs, and T20Is.

Yesterday, she achieved this milestone in the first T20 International against England, played in Nottingham, where she scored a brilliant 112 runs.

Batting first, India posted a massive total of 210 runs. Mandhana’s innings featured 3 sixes and 15 fours.

So far in her career, Mandhana has recorded 2 Test centuries and 11 ODI centuries.

Meanwhile, India secured an emphatic 97-run victory in this match against England.

In reply to India’s imposing 210/5 in 20 overs, England managed only 113 runs.

This defeat is also notable as it marks England’s heaviest loss by runs against India in women’s T20 cricket history.
